The Bayreuth info point: What you need to know
Category
Details
Location
Bayreuth, Bavaria, Germany
Population
Around 72,000
Main Attractions
Bayreuth Festival, Margravial Opera House, Eremitage Palace and Park
Best Time to Visit
May to September
Weather
Moderate continental climate with warm summers and cold winters
Transportation
Bayreuth has a well-connected public transportation system, including buses and trams
Accommodation
Various hotels, guesthouses, and holiday rentals available in the city
Local Cuisine
Famous for Franconian dishes such as Bratwurst, Schäufele, and Bamberger Hörnla potatoes

What's the weather like in Bayreuth?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 17°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 1°C. Average annual precipitation for Bayreuth is 910 mm.
